在网站建设与运营过程中,域名跳转几乎是每个站长都会遇到的问题。比如网站从旧域名迁移到新域名、将不带www的域名统一跳转到带www的主域名、把http统一跳转到https,甚至是多端口、多入口地址的访问整合,这些场景背后都离不开一个核心动作:301重定向。很多人第一次接触时,常常会把阿里云301重定向想得很复杂,担心配置错了导致搜索引擎收录异常,或者网站直接无法访问。实际上,只要理解原理、明确场景、按步骤执行,新手也能一次成功。

这篇文章将围绕阿里云301重定向展开,从基础概念、适用场景、准备工作,到阿里云常见环境中的具体配置方法,再到排错思路、SEO注意事项与实际案例,尽量讲透讲明,让你不仅会“照着做”,还知道“为什么这么做”。
什么是301重定向,为什么它如此重要
301重定向,本质上是一种永久性跳转。当用户或搜索引擎访问旧网址时,服务器会返回一个301状态码,告诉对方:这个页面已经永久迁移到新的地址,请以后优先访问新地址。与302临时重定向相比,301更适合正式迁移和长期统一入口,因为它会向搜索引擎释放明确的迁移信号,有助于权重继承与索引更新。
对于网站运营者来说,301重定向的重要性主要体现在几个方面。第一,统一访问入口,避免同一内容被多个URL访问,减少重复收录问题。第二,提升品牌识别度,比如把example.com统一跳转到www.example.com,或者反过来。第三,在网站升级HTTPS后,将所有HTTP请求自动导向HTTPS,提高安全性与用户信任感。第四,在域名更换或业务重构时,保留历史流量价值,避免老用户访问失效页面。
也正因为如此,阿里云301重定向并不仅仅是“做个跳转”那么简单,它往往关系到网站流量、SEO表现、用户体验,甚至广告投放与外链价值的延续。
阿里云301重定向常见应用场景
在阿里云环境下,301重定向的使用场景非常丰富。最常见的一类,是主域名统一。比如有些用户会直接输入不带www的域名,而企业希望所有访问都统一落到www版本,以保证品牌展示一致。这时候就需要把example.com做301跳转到www.example.com。
第二类场景是协议升级。如今HTTPS几乎已成为网站标配,如果你已经部署了SSL证书,就应该尽量把所有HTTP请求通过301重定向到HTTPS版本,这样既利于安全,也有助于搜索引擎识别规范地址。
第三类场景是新旧域名切换。企业改名、品牌升级、业务整合时,经常会启用新域名。如果旧域名还有大量历史外链、收录页面和老用户访问入口,最稳妥的做法就是使用301永久重定向将它们导向新域名对应页面。
第四类场景是目录或页面级迁移。比如原来的文章中心在/news/目录下,后来改版迁移到了/blog/目录,这时候也可以通过301规则批量映射路径,降低改版带来的流量损失。
无论是哪一种,阿里云301重定向的核心原则都一样:明确唯一目标地址,避免循环跳转,尽量保持路径对应关系,并在上线前做好测试。
正式配置前,你需要准备什么
很多新手之所以配置失败,不是因为不会写规则,而是前置条件没有理顺。在阿里云301重定向开始之前,建议先确认以下几项内容。
- 确认域名解析是否正确,旧域名和目标域名都应指向正确的服务器或服务节点。
- 确认服务器环境,是Nginx、Apache、IIS,还是阿里云对象存储OSS、CDN、负载均衡等不同产品。
- 确认目标站点可正常访问,尤其是在做HTTP到HTTPS跳转时,HTTPS站点必须已经部署好SSL证书。
- 确认是否需要保留原路径与参数,例如从old.com/a?id=1跳转到new.com/a?id=1,还是统一跳到首页。
- 确认是否存在其他跳转规则,避免新旧规则冲突,造成多次跳转或循环跳转。
如果你能提前把这些问题梳理清楚,后面的阿里云301重定向配置会顺畅很多。
阿里云服务器上配置301重定向的基本思路
阿里云本质上提供的是云资源和云服务,而301跳转规则通常最终落在具体的Web服务层面。也就是说,如果你的网站部署在阿里云ECS服务器上,那么常见做法是在Nginx或Apache中配置重定向规则;如果你的网站接入了CDN,也可以在CDN层做跳转;如果是静态站点托管在OSS,则可以利用相关跳转功能实现。
对于大多数中小网站而言,最常见的是ECS搭配Nginx。因为Nginx性能稳定、语法清晰,做域名统一或HTTP跳HTTPS都比较方便。如果你用的是宝塔面板,虽然也可以通过可视化方式设置跳转,但本质上仍然是往Nginx或Apache配置中写入规则。理解这一点很重要,因为以后你排查问题时,就知道应该去哪里看配置文件和日志。
Nginx环境下的阿里云301重定向设置方法
先说最常见的一种:把不带www的域名跳转到带www的域名。假设你的主域名是www.example.com,希望用户访问example.com时自动跳到www.example.com,那么你可以在Nginx中为example.com单独写一个server配置,监听80端口,并返回301到目标域名。
这里的关键逻辑并不复杂:旧域名负责接收请求,然后通过301把请求发往新域名。为了用户体验更好,通常建议保留原始请求路径。也就是说,用户访问example.com/about,应该跳转到www.example.com/about,而不是一律跳到首页。这样不仅更自然,也更利于SEO。
如果你还希望同时实现HTTP到HTTPS跳转,那么通常需要分层处理。第一层,把所有HTTP请求导向HTTPS;第二层,再统一域名版本。为了减少跳转次数,最好直接一步到位。例如用户访问http://example.com/news,可以直接301到https://www.example.com/news,而不是先跳到http://www.example.com/news,再跳到https://www.example.com/news。多一次跳转,就多一层损耗,也增加了异常概率。
很多新手在做阿里云301重定向时,最大的问题就是把规则拆得过于零散,最后出现链式跳转。看起来功能都实现了,但访问过程经历了两次甚至三次301,这会拖慢首屏打开速度,也不利于搜索引擎抓取效率。
Apache环境下如何处理301跳转
如果你的阿里云服务器使用的是Apache,那么301重定向通常可以通过虚拟主机配置文件,或者网站根目录下的重写规则文件来完成。Apache在URL重写方面同样成熟,适合做域名统一、协议跳转、目录迁移等操作。
与Nginx相比,Apache在共享主机时代更常见,所以不少老网站仍然跑在这个环境中。对于这类站点,做阿里云301重定向时,最重要的是明确规则执行顺序。因为Apache的重写条件和规则一旦叠加过多,容易出现“本来想匹配A,结果先被B拦截”的情况。因此,建议把最核心、最广泛的规则放在前面,把特殊页面的例外处理放在后面。
例如你要把旧域名整体跳转到新域名,但其中某个下载目录不希望跳转,就要先写排除条件,再写通用跳转规则。这样可以避免误伤业务功能。
使用阿里云CDN实现301重定向的优势
当网站流量逐渐变大,或者希望把跳转逻辑前置到网络边缘节点时,通过阿里云CDN实现301重定向会是一个不错的选择。它的优势在于,用户请求还没到源站,就可以在CDN节点完成重定向,减少源站压力,也让跳转响应更快。
这种方式特别适合以下场景:旧域名已经接入CDN,希望快速批量迁移;需要统一HTTP到HTTPS跳转;或者需要在全国范围内稳定处理海量重定向请求。对于企业级业务而言,把阿里云301重定向放在CDN层,有时比直接改源站配置更灵活。
不过要注意的是,CDN层跳转虽然高效,但你仍然需要梳理好域名解析、证书部署、回源配置等基础项。如果CDN规则和源站规则同时生效,依然可能造成重复跳转。因此,最佳实践是明确“谁负责最终跳转”,尽量避免多层同时改写。
HTTP跳HTTPS时最容易踩的坑
阿里云301重定向中,HTTP跳HTTPS看似简单,实际上是最容易出问题的一类配置。第一种常见问题是HTTPS证书未正确部署。用户一跳过去就看到证书错误页面,这不仅影响体验,也会让搜索引擎对站点稳定性产生负面判断。
第二种问题是站内资源混合加载。页面虽然跳到了HTTPS,但图片、JS、CSS仍然使用HTTP地址,浏览器就会提示不安全内容,甚至拦截资源加载。严格来说,这不是301本身的错误,但经常与HTTPS跳转同时出现。
第三种问题是跳转规则写反。比如本意是80端口跳443,结果443端口也被错误地写成继续跳自己,最终形成死循环。用户看到的通常就是“重定向次数过多”。这种情况在新手操作中非常典型。
所以做这类阿里云301重定向时,建议先确保HTTPS站点独立访问完全正常,再开启从HTTP到HTTPS的跳转。不要一边修证书、一边做301,否则排查起来会很混乱。
案例一:企业官网从旧域名迁移到新域名
一家做工业设备的企业,原来使用的是拼音缩写域名,后来品牌升级后启用了更易记的新域名。旧网站在搜索引擎中已经积累了数百个收录页面,也有大量行业平台外链。如果直接停掉旧域名,用户点击旧链接就会进入404页面,历史流量基本等于清零。
后来他们采用了阿里云301重定向方案:旧域名保留一年以上,服务器上将旧页面一一对应跳转到新页面,同时提交新站点地图,并在搜索引擎站长平台完成改版或迁移相关操作。一个多月后,新域名的收录逐步稳定,旧域名的品牌词流量也顺利传递到了新站点。
这个案例说明,301重定向不是简单地“把旧站关掉换新站”,而是一次流量资产转移。尤其是企业官网、行业站、资讯站这类依赖自然搜索流量的网站,更应该重视迁移质量。
案例二:商城统一主域名,提升收录规范性
另一家电商站曾经同时存在四种可访问地址:带www的HTTP、不带www的HTTP、带www的HTTPS、不带www的HTTPS。用户从不同渠道进入时,看到的地址并不统一,搜索引擎也收录了多个重复版本,导致权重分散严重。
技术人员在阿里云服务器上重新梳理了访问入口,最终只保留一个标准地址:HTTPS加www版本。其余三种入口全部通过301永久重定向到标准地址,并补充了规范标签、站内绝对链接修正和站点地图更新。两个月后,站点重复收录明显下降,核心分类页排名也更稳定。
这类问题在中小商城里很普遍。很多人以为只要网站能打开就行,实际上,入口不统一会让搜索引擎难以判断哪个URL才是主版本。阿里云301重定向在这里承担的是“统一规范”的角色,而不只是“访问跳转”。
如何判断301重定向是否配置成功
做完配置后,千万不要只在浏览器里打开看一眼。因为浏览器会缓存跳转结果,有时即使配置有误,也会被缓存“掩盖”。更可靠的检查方法包括以下几个方面。
- 使用状态码检测工具,确认返回的是301而不是302或其他状态码。
- 检查是否一步直达目标地址,避免出现多次跳转。
- 分别测试首页、栏目页、内容页以及带参数链接,确认路径保留是否正确。
- 测试PC端和移动端访问,排除因不同规则导致的跳转异常。
- 查看服务器日志或CDN日志,确认请求命中的是预期规则。
如果你是在阿里云环境中操作,建议顺便查看安全组、负载均衡监听、CDN回源和DNS解析是否都一致。有些看似是301配置失败,实际上是请求根本没有到达你认为的那一层服务。
阿里云301重定向的SEO注意事项
301重定向与SEO关系非常紧密,因此不能只从“能不能跳”来判断配置质量。首先,永久跳转必须尽量稳定,不要今天跳、明天取消,频繁变动会影响搜索引擎判断。其次,目标页面应尽量与原页面主题一致,最理想的是一对一对应。若把所有旧页面都粗暴地跳到新首页,虽然技术上实现了阿里云301重定向,但SEO效果通常并不好。
再次,迁移后要同步更新站内链接、导航、canonical规范标签、XML网站地图以及各类外部平台资料。如果站内还大量引用旧地址,搜索引擎会持续抓取旧URL,延缓新地址稳定收录。最后,旧域名不要过早放弃。理论上,301信号会逐步传递,但实际周期与站点体量、抓取频率、链接质量都有关。保留足够长时间的跳转规则,通常更稳妥。
为什么会出现“重定向次数过多”
这是新手最常遇到的问题之一。出现这个报错,通常意味着跳转形成了循环。最典型的几种情况包括:HTTP跳到HTTPS,而HTTPS又被错误规则跳回HTTP;不带www跳到带www,但带www又被另一条规则跳回不带www;CDN层做了一次跳转,源站层又根据不同条件跳回原地址。
排查时,不要凭感觉改来改去,而要画出访问路径。比如用户访问的原始地址是什么,请求先经过DNS、CDN、负载均衡还是直接到源站,在哪一层返回了301,目标地址又被谁再次改写。把链路画出来,问题通常就会非常清楚。
所以,阿里云301重定向要想一次成功,最重要的不是记住多少命令,而是保持规则设计清晰:只保留一个最终目标,只在必要层做跳转,确保每个入口都朝同一个方向收敛。
新手实操时的建议:先小范围测试,再全站上线
如果你是第一次做阿里云301重定向,不建议直接在生产站大面积修改。更稳妥的方法是先做小范围测试。比如先拿一个二级域名或测试域名验证规则逻辑,确认状态码、路径保留、HTTPS证书、缓存行为都没问题后,再应用到正式站点。
同时,修改前最好备份原配置文件。万一上线后发现异常,可以迅速回滚。对于流量较大的网站,建议选择低峰时段操作,并提前观察监控、日志和抓取情况。技术配置看似只是几分钟的事,但真正稳定运行,往往取决于准备工作和上线后的验证细节。
结语:掌握原理,阿里云301重定向并不难
很多人一提到阿里云301重定向,就联想到复杂的服务器命令、繁琐的规则和看不懂的状态码。其实只要你先想清楚目标:到底要统一哪个域名、哪个协议、哪些路径,再结合自己的部署环境选择Nginx、Apache、CDN或其他阿里云产品来实施,整个过程并没有想象中那么难。
真正决定成败的,不是你复制了哪一段配置,而是你是否理解了301永久重定向的作用,是否考虑了SEO影响,是否避免了重复跳转和循环跳转,是否在上线前后做了充分测试。掌握这些方法后,无论是企业官网迁移、商城主域名统一,还是HTTP升级HTTPS,你都可以更从容地完成配置。
如果你正在为网站入口混乱、旧域名迁移、HTTPS统一访问这些问题发愁,不妨按照本文的思路一步步操作。只要逻辑理顺、步骤到位,阿里云301重定向完全可以做到稳定、规范,而且新手也能一次成功。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云小编。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/162582.html